Spinneret assembly for spinning polymeric fibers
11306413 · 2022-04-19 · ·

A spinneret assembly for spinning polymeric fibers, including: (a) a cap provided with an inlet port and a flared lower surface that flares outwardly from the inlet port in the direction of flow; (b) a spinneret having numerous spinning flow channels through its thickness; (c) a filter freely resting on the spinneret; and (d) a flow guide with a tapered geometry mounted in a cavity defined by the cap and the spinneret. The flow guide has an apex facing the inlet port, a base facing the filter, and one or more side surfaces tapering up to the apex. A diverging flow passage is defined by the tapering side surface(s) of the flow guide and the cap's flared lower surface. The base of the flow guide is spaced apart from an upper surface of the spinneret, creating a space that is in fluid communication with the divergent flow passage.

PLANT FOR TREATMENT OF POLYMERIC MATERIALS
20220024103 · 2022-01-27 · ·

A plastics material transformation plant (100) comprises a transformation machine (10) for the plastics material by means of moulding or extrusion, a feeding hopper (13) which is positioned upstream of the transformation machine and a metering device (1) which is arranged to add a liquid additive to the transformation machine. The metering device (1) comprises a container (4) in which the liquid additive is contained, a metering pump (5) which is connected to the container in order to take the liquid additive and to supply it to the transformation machine (10), and a thermo-regulation system of the liquid additive which is arranged to maintain the temperature of the liquid additive in a range of 2° C. more or 2° C. less than a predetermined temperature value.

Method and device for determining a layer property of a layer in an extrusion process
11225008 · 2022-01-18 · ·

Method for determining at least one layer property of a layer to be determined, in particular a foam layer, in an extrusion process, where a supply material is at least partially foamed and an extrusion product with the foam layer is put out (in other words, is output). The method has at least the steps of irradiating the extrusion product using electro-magnetic radiation, and electro-magnetically measuring at least one radiation having travelled through the foam layer. Measuring at least one feed-in rate or feed-in volume of the supply material, and determining the at least one material property of the layer to be determined from the measured feed-in volume and the electro-magnetic measurement.

Method for producing plastic products by means of an extruder, and shaping system
11648720 · 2023-05-16 · ·

The invention relates to a process for the production of articles, exemplarily a plastic article, by means of an extruder (1) to which a first plastic composition of a first main component and at least one associated minor component is supplied from a first group of dosing stations (21, 24). According to the invention, during the production time of a first production order there is prepared a second group of dosing stations (31, 33) at the extruder for a second production order for which a second plastic composition of a second main component and at least one associated minor component that is different from the first plastic composition has to be supplied to the extruder. After completion of the first production order it is reset to the second production order by terminating the supply of the first plastic composition by closing a first shut-off device (8) and starting the supply of the second plastic composition by opening a second shut-off device (8′).

SELF-CLEANING GRAVIMETRIC AND VOLUMETRIC DOSING APPARATUSES
20220212366 · 2022-07-07 ·

A self-cleaning dosing apparatus includes a material hopper for containing pellets of material, a feed screw, a first material outlet through which pellets of material fall by gravity onto a first end of the feed screw for the feeding of pellets to a process machine. A second material outlet is located beneath the first end of the feed screw, with a slide gate blocking the second material outlet. A pneumatic piston is provided for pulling the slide gate to unblock the second material outlet, and a Venturi pump is located under the second material outlet for pulling pellets through the second material outlet when the slide gate is opened.

Method for the step-by-step guidance of a machine operator of an extrusion device when changing from an application formula to a subsequent formula

The present invention relates to a method for the step-by-step guidance of a machine operator of an extrusion device for a film machine when changing from an application formula to a subsequent formula, comprising the following steps: identifying a formula change request, displaying the formula change request for the machine operator, displaying at least one concluding step to be performed for the application formula, identifying a confirmation of the machine operator for the at least one concluding step, displaying at least one preparatory step to be performed for the subsequent formula, identifying a confirmation of the machine operator for the at least one preparatory step, and concluding the change from the application formula to the subsequent formula.

Extrusion device and extrusion method that produces a plastic film

An extrusion device that produces plastic film includes at least two feed units that feed feedstock for an extruder, wherein, in each feed unit an automatic cleaning device is arranged for a removal of feedstock from the feed unit when changing material in the extrusion device.

Method for changing the material in an extrusion device
11117305 · 2021-09-14 · ·

The present invention relates to a method for changing material in an extrusion device comprising at least two supply devices for supplying feedstock for an extruder, comprising the following steps: identifying a change request for changing material in an extrusion device, predetermining a production stability for a time after the material of at least one supply device has been changed, comparing the predetermined production stability to a threshold value of stability, changing the material in at least one supply device depending on the result of comparison.
